草庐IT

hadoop - 每当我更改 xml 配置文件时,是否需要重新启动所有 hadoop 守护进程

假设我的hadoop集群正在运行并且我对hdfs-site.xml进行了更改。我的问题是在这种情况下需要重新启动哪些服务/守护进程?同样,如果我对yarn-site.xml、core-site.xml、mapred-site.xml进行更改,哪些守护进程需要重新启动,allocations.xml或者我应该在上述每种情况下重新启动所有守护进程吗? 最佳答案 我的问题得到了答案。答案是这取决于我们要更改的服务配置属性。比方说,如果我们更改名称节点属性,我们需要重新启动HDFS服务。 关于h

【Flink-Kafka-To-Mysql】使用 Flink 实现 Kafka 数据写入 Mysql(根据对应操作类型进行增、删、改操作)

【Flink-Kafka-To-Mysql】使用Flink实现Kafka数据写入Mysql(根据对应操作类型进行增、删、改操作)1)导入依赖2)resources2.1.appconfig.yml2.2.application.properties2.3.log4j.properties2.4.log4j2.xml3)util3.1.KafkaMysqlUtils3.2.CustomDeSerializationSchema4)po4.1.TableBean5)kafkacdc2mysql5.1.Kafka2MysqlApp需求描述:1、数据从Kafka写入Mysql。2、相关配置存放于Mys

hadoop - 在 hadoop 中修改集群属性时是否需要重新启动守护进程?

假设默认情况下复制因子是3,我想知道如果我们将复制因子修改为2,我们是否需要重新启动hadoop守护进程以使更改生效?如果是这样,那么有什么特定的原因为什么会这样吗?换句话说,如果说无需重启hadoop集群即可应用配置,会出现什么样的问题? 最佳答案 https://hadoop.apache.org/docs/r0.18.3/hdfs_shell.html定义如下命令:setrepUsage:hadoopfs-setrep[-R]Changesthereplicationfactorofafile.-Roptionisforrec

php - 如何在php中修改上传文件的内容类型?

我想使用图片上传API。它通过POST接收图像文件并向我发送我上传的图像的URI。但是如果图像的内容类型不是一种图像mime类型(例如图像/jpeg、图像/png、...),该API会向我发送错误但是当我通过FTP上传图像文件并使用CURL作为文件上传时,它会向我发送错误,因为该图像的Content-Type始终是“application/octet-stream”。我想修改这个mime类型。有什么办法可以修改吗?代码如下:"@/files.jpg");$ch=curl_init();curl_setopt($ch,CURLOPT_URL,"http://uix.kr/widget/p

C++:stack、queue、priority_queue增删查改模拟实现、deque底层原理

C++:stack、queue、priority_queue增删查改模拟实现前言一、C++stack的介绍和使用1.1引言1.2satck模拟实现二、C++queue的介绍和使用2.1引言2.2queue增删查改模拟实现三、STL标准库中stack和queue的底层结构:deque3.1deque的简单介绍(了解)3.2deque的缺陷3.3为什么选择deque作为stack和queue的底层默认容器四、priority_queue的介绍和实现4.1priority_queue的介绍4.1priority_queue的介绍增删查改模拟实现前言4.1.1push()4.1.2pop()4.3to

php - Composer workflow : How to update composer. 当我更改依赖项时锁定

该项目是通过composer.pharinstall--prefer-source设置的,并且包含很多保存在git中的模块。我在我的IDE(PhpStorm)中管理所有这些模块及其git存储库,因此可能会向vendor/文件夹中的某些模块提交一些更改-直接提交到源git存储库。我现在如何确保我的同事在执行composer.phar安装时获得我最近的模块版本(composer.lock在repo中)?如果我进行本地composer.phar更新它看起来像composer.lock没有更新,因为我已经有最新版本(因为我刚刚做了直接在vendor文件夹中提交) 最

如何在 Idea 中修改文件的字符集(如:UTF-8)

以IntelliJIDEA2023.2(UltimateEdition)为例,如下:点击左上角【IntelliJIDEA】->【Settings…】,如下图:从弹出页面的左侧导航中找到【Editor】->【FileEncodings】,并将GlobalEncoding、ProjectEncoding、Defaultencodingforpropertiesfiles选项都设置为您想要的字符集,例如:UTF-8。如下图:

改bug更高效,手把手教你配置IntelliJ IDEA插件CheckStyle和Findbugs

维护良好的代码质量是软件开发中的重要要素。为了帮助开发人员发现问题和改进代码,可以将CheckStyle和Findbugs插件集成到IntelliJIDEA中。这两个插件提供了代码风格检查和静态代码分析的功能,有助于编写更好的代码。本文介绍安装和配置这些插件的步骤,以及其用途和优势。1安装CheckStyle这里有两种方法供使用:1.1使用IDEA插件菜单安装CheckStylesa) 如果你使用的是Mac,转到Preferences(偏好设置)>Plugins(插件)。(否则转到File>Setting>Plugins(设置>插件))。b) 输入CheckStyle并安装最新的插件版本。c)

android - 在 Android Studio 中修改 compileSdkVersion 报错

我正在AndroidStudio中测试一个应用程序,我需要使用低于23的compileSdkVersion,但AndroidStudio中当前compileSdkVersion的默认版本是23.我下载并安装了AndroidSDKbuild-tools修订版22,并在build.gradle中将其更改如下:android{compileSdkVersion22buildToolsVersion"23.0.1"但是我收到了这个错误:cause:failedtofindtargetwithhashstring'android-22'我看过一些类似的问题,但没有一个能帮助我解决这个问题。我该怎

如何将笔记本改服务器?

Windowns旧笔记本改造为服务器    这次记录的初始原因是抱着自己部分项目线上测试,但是看了一圈,若是专门买一台云服务器,价格还是比较贵(就是穷!!!)的原因,所以有了将旧笔记本改为服务器的想法,只要给笔记本装上Centos7的系统,然后内网穿透这就妥妥的成了自己的服务器了,不香么?(穷快乐!!)一、安装Linux系统   由于是一台旧笔记本,所以这里不再搞什么虚拟机之类的了,我就直接上Linux系统了。1.下载Centos7镜像阿里云地址:7.9版本的,想要其他版本也可以选择别的。或者官网地址:CentOSMirrorsList 2.制作系统盘    熟悉的朋友可以跳过这一步了。